Fri Sep 20 16:53:38 UTC 2024: ## KL Rahul’s Temperament Questioned After Poor First Test Innings

Former India cricketer Sanjay Manjrekar believes KL Rahul’s struggles in the first Test against Bangladesh stem from a “temperamental problem”. Despite being a technically gifted batsman with several Test centuries to his name, Rahul’s overall average of 34 raises concerns about his consistency and mental approach.

Manjrekar, drawing from his own experience, pointed out that Rahul’s batting often lacks purpose, appearing as if he’s focusing solely on technique rather than instinctive run-scoring. “He’s got some brilliant hundreds, but an average of 34… that tells you about his temperament,” Manjrekar remarked.

Rahul, who has been dropped from the Indian T20 squad and is facing mounting pressure to perform, managed only 16 runs in the first innings, failing to make a significant impact. His performance further fuelled questions about his place in the Test team, particularly given his underwhelming recent form.

This analysis emphasizes the importance of mental fortitude in Test cricket, where long periods of pressure and intense scrutiny can significantly impact a batsman’s performance. Whether Rahul can overcome this perceived “temperamental problem” and rediscover his form remains to be seen.
